Big fish lost!
New member Sandy Newland's reports that he lost 2 very big fish on Friday night (double figure monsters)! Despite heavy rain he continued fishing yet still had many offers as well. He says that there were fish running through in large numbers and many were really large fish too! Others fishing that night didn't connect as far as he is aware. Bad luck Sandy!
